[neon/kde/kwayland-server/Neon/unstable] debian: remove tight ABI coupling mechanism. we remove pkg symbols helper because it causes excessively tight version dependencies of packages when they are not needed and this is just another way to do the same thing

Jonathan Riddell null at kde.org
Thu Jun 24 11:21:07 BST 2021


Git commit c00075ff8230d0760b44f93a5503996724ec8aeb by Jonathan Riddell.
Committed on 24/06/2021 at 10:21.
Pushed by jriddell into branch 'Neon/unstable'.

remove tight ABI coupling mechanism.  we remove pkg symbols helper because it causes excessively tight version dependencies of packages when they are not needed and this is just another way to do the same thing

M  +0    -1    debian/control

https://invent.kde.org/neon/kde/kwayland-server/commit/c00075ff8230d0760b44f93a5503996724ec8aeb

diff --git a/debian/control b/debian/control
index 0c5b176..ad2842c 100644
--- a/debian/control
+++ b/debian/control
@@ -37,7 +37,6 @@ Description: Qt library wrapper for Wayland libraries
  the Wayland libraries.
  .
  This package contains the shared library.
-Provides: ${ABI:VirtualPackage}
 
 Package: libkwaylandserver-dev
 Section: libdevel


More information about the Neon-commits mailing list